Get a Free Quote
From repairs to installations, experience lasting results.
BBB A+
Google 5-Star
Licensed & Insured
Contact Information
Call Us
1-781-808-3662
Email Us
info@weymouthgaragedoor.com
Visit Us
9 Briarwood Trl, Weymouth, MA 02188
Hours
24/7 Emergency Service
Mon-Sat: 8AM - 6PM